Record low for Democratic Party favorable ratings in new national poll

the Democratic Party Classified classifications have declined to their lowest levels, according to two new national polls.
Only 29 % of those interrogated in a CNN poll that were released on Sunday says they have a positive viewpoint of the party, with 54 % with an unfavorable vision.
This is a low record in the CNN survey, which dates back to more than three decades.
The preference of Democrats has decreased four points since early January, before the start of the president Donald Trump A second service tour of the White House, which is 20 points from January 2021, before the start of former President Joe Biden in his position.

Only 63 % of Democrats and independents with democratic tendencies that were interrogated in the poll said they had a positive view of the party, a decrease of 72 % in January and a decrease from 81 % four years ago, at the beginning of the Biden administration.
It was a similar story in the NBC News National poll issued on Sunday.
Only 27 % of registered voters said they had a positive vision of the Democratic Party, which was the slightest classification of the party in the NBC news survey dating back to 1990. NBC News PolL from 7 to 11 March.
The Democratic Party in the political wilderness, after the setbacks of the November elections, when the Republicans won the control of the White House and the Senate, and defended the majority of their fragile house. Republicans have made gains between black and Latin voters, as well as younger voters, all of whom are traditional members at the Democratic Party base.

According to the CNN poll – which was conducted from 6 to 9 March by SSRS – the positive classification of the Republican Party is 36 %, with 48 % of unfavorable vision of The Republican Party.
The positive Republican Party classification has not changed as of January, with a four -point unfavorable classification.
The Republican Party was also underwater in the NBC News survey, with 39 % favorable and 49 % unwanted.
The new surveys, which were released on Sunday, follow a Coinibiac National University poll Last month, the main headlines occupied the indication that the preference of Democrats had reached its lowest level in their polls dating back to 2009.

New CNN Survey It also indicates that with a margin of 57 % -42 %, Democrats say their leaders should often work to stop the Republican Party’s agenda instead of trying to find a common ground with Republicans.
This turned from the ballot at the beginning of Trump’s first term in office, when nearly three quarters of Democrats said that their party should work with the Republicans.
There was a similar discovery in the NBC News poll, where nearly two -thirds of the congressional Democrats in Congress wanted to abide by their positions instead of making concessions with Trump. The numbers in the NBC News poll are also a shift from its findings during the first months of the first Trump administration.
Both opinions were made before the move last week by 10 Democrats in the Senate, including the leader of the minority Chuck Schumer, DN.Y, to vote for the federal government spending bill made from the Republican Party that avoids the closure of the government.
This step has angered many on the left, who want their party to take a tougher stance in resisting Trump’s agenda.
